Transaction 21f753214699eeeac7a2a18fdccd065bd7af3fa2ca8138c974c4625b44e25d24

1 Input
2 Outputs
  • 21f753214699eeeac7a2a18fdccd065bd7af3fa2ca8138c974c4625b44e25d24:0
  • value  72145
    address  38s7W6A61aF1S5hS7mpkPuPM7dczDb2JfY
  • 21f753214699eeeac7a2a18fdccd065bd7af3fa2ca8138c974c4625b44e25d24:1
  • value  29125
    address  bc1qxa8zzvt642mg2ymgxvhgcccvfvzgew7jtcyaqm